Index: chrome/browser/chromeos/policy/remote_commands/screenshot_delegate.cc |
diff --git a/chrome/browser/chromeos/policy/remote_commands/screenshot_delegate.cc b/chrome/browser/chromeos/policy/remote_commands/screenshot_delegate.cc |
index fe9264c2a3ce02e1b5356ddf8dc2b4a259381a3c..eec0979395c89a1f0f80c3e406f44673ea92191e 100644 |
--- a/chrome/browser/chromeos/policy/remote_commands/screenshot_delegate.cc |
+++ b/chrome/browser/chromeos/policy/remote_commands/screenshot_delegate.cc |
@@ -42,7 +42,7 @@ void ScreenshotDelegate::TakeSnapshot( |
gfx::NativeWindow window, |
const gfx::Rect& source_rect, |
const ui::GrabWindowSnapshotAsyncPNGCallback& callback) { |
- ui::GrabWindowSnapshotAsync( |
+ ui::GrabWindowSnapshotAsyncPNG( |
window, source_rect, blocking_task_runner_, |
base::Bind(&ScreenshotDelegate::StoreScreenshot, |
weak_ptr_factory_.GetWeakPtr(), callback)); |
@@ -69,7 +69,7 @@ std::unique_ptr<UploadJob> ScreenshotDelegate::CreateUploadJob( |
void ScreenshotDelegate::StoreScreenshot( |
const ui::GrabWindowSnapshotAsyncPNGCallback& callback, |
- scoped_refptr<base::RefCountedBytes> png_data) { |
+ scoped_refptr<base::RefCountedMemory> png_data) { |
callback.Run(png_data); |
} |